Output 143b1d8cfa0c58cef439a8f6abdeff690cedf446c64d0341968b6b7b21ae092b:1

value
6448000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f95abfcf8300af861e002911d64912d52a995151 OP_EQUAL
address
3QRUtgKGrmDpsbdcKSiZ67yvRUYvZy9faN
transaction
143b1d8cfa0c58cef439a8f6abdeff690cedf446c64d0341968b6b7b21ae092b
spent
true